Records ace at Riviera
February 22, 2021
Harrington closed with a one-under 70 on Sunday at the Genesis Invitational to finish two-under and tied for 26th.
ANALYSIS
Harrington's week at Riviera Country Club was highlighted by an ace on the par-3 sixth hole during Sunday's final round, and he's now made the cut in back-to-back starts after placing 66th at the AT&T Pebble Beach Pro-Am. However, Harrington has elected not to play in this week's Puerto Rico Open after appearing in the original list of entrants.

Harrington nearly reached the $1M mark in official earnings during his first season on the PGA Tour in 2019-20, but he finished just 172nd in the FedExCup standings the following year and he was consequently relegated back down to the Korn Ferry Tour. Throughout his 2022 campaign on the KFT, Harrington ranked seventh in ball striking despite making only eight cuts in 21 starts. Nonetheless, he earned his PGA Tour card for the 2022-23 season with a T4 finish at the Albertsons Boise Open during the first leg of the KFT Finals.
A rookie at age 39, Harrington played only four PGA Tour events before last season. He played 22 in 2019-20, making half the cuts. About two-thirds of his cash and points came from one event - runner-up at the Houston Open. We can't count on that happening again.
Despite closing in on his 40s, Harrington could be an intriguing prospect when considering short-term deep sleepers among the 2019-20 rookie class. En route to finishing 19th on the Regular Season Points List, he ranked fourth in ball striking, fifth in all-around, fourth in birdie average and sixth in total driving. Harrington is also heating up just in time for the wraparound fall series, placing T3-MC-T28-T11-2-T14 from the TPC Colorado Championship to the Nationwide Children's Hospital Championship.
